编程又可以叫什么名称来着
-
编程又可以称为计算机编程、软件开发、程序设计等。它是一种通过编写代码来创建、实现和修改计算机程序的过程。编程的目的是让计算机按照特定的指令执行任务,实现各种功能。在编程过程中,程序员使用特定的编程语言来表达和组织算法和逻辑,从而实现所需的功能。编程可以涉及多个领域,包括应用开发、网站开发、游戏开发、数据分析、人工智能等。通过编程,人们可以利用计算机的强大计算能力和处理能力,解决各种实际问题,提高工作效率,改善生活质量。编程也是一种创造性和逻辑思维的体现,它需要程序员具备良好的问题分析和解决能力,以及对计算机系统和编程语言的深入理解。随着科技的不断发展,编程已经成为了一项重要的技能,许多人都将其作为自己的职业发展方向。通过学习和掌握编程,人们可以打开创新的大门,创造出各种令人惊叹的应用和产品。总之,编程是一项充满挑战和乐趣的技能,它在现代社会中具有重要的地位和作用。
1年前 -
编程可以被称为软件开发、编码、计算机编程或程序设计。
1年前 -
编程又被称为计算机编程、软件开发、程序设计等。这些术语都指的是使用特定的编程语言和工具来创建和实现计算机程序的过程。编程涉及到设计算法、编写代码、调试和测试代码等一系列操作,最终目的是使计算机能够按照预定的逻辑执行特定的任务。在编程过程中,开发者需要遵循一定的方法和操作流程来完成程序的开发和优化。接下来将详细介绍编程的方法和操作流程。
一、编程方法
编程方法是指在编写代码时使用的一系列技术和策略,它们有助于提高代码的可读性、可维护性和可扩展性。下面列举了一些常用的编程方法:-
面向对象编程(Object-Oriented Programming,简称OOP):面向对象编程是一种将程序设计问题分解为对象的方法。对象是一个包含数据和对数据进行操作的方法的实体。面向对象编程的核心概念包括封装、继承和多态。
-
函数式编程(Functional Programming):函数式编程强调使用纯函数来实现程序逻辑,避免使用共享状态和可变数据。函数式编程的核心思想是将计算过程视为函数的应用。
-
声明式编程(Declarative Programming):声明式编程是一种通过描述问题的性质和约束来解决问题的方法,而不是直接指定解决问题的步骤。声明式编程的例子包括SQL和正则表达式。
-
过程化编程(Procedural Programming):过程化编程是一种基于过程(也称为子程序或函数)的编程方法。它将程序分解为一系列的过程,每个过程执行特定的任务。
二、编程操作流程
编程操作流程是指在进行软件开发时的一系列步骤和活动。以下是典型的编程操作流程:-
需求分析:在开始编程之前,首先需要明确程序的需求和目标。这包括了解用户的需求、功能要求、性能要求等。需求分析的结果将指导后续的开发工作。
-
设计:在需求分析的基础上,进行软件系统的设计。设计阶段包括定义系统的结构、模块和组件的功能和接口。设计过程应该考虑代码的可读性、可维护性、可扩展性等。
-
编码:根据设计的结果,开始编写代码。编码过程包括根据需求编写代码、调试代码、进行单元测试等。在编码过程中,需要选择合适的编程语言和工具,并遵循编码规范和最佳实践。
-
测试:编码完成后,需要对代码进行测试。测试包括单元测试、集成测试、系统测试等。测试的目的是验证代码的正确性、稳定性和性能。
-
调试:如果在测试过程中发现了问题,需要进行调试。调试是通过定位问题的原因和修复代码来解决问题的过程。调试技巧和工具对于快速定位和解决问题非常重要。
-
部署和维护:在代码通过测试并且没有问题后,可以将代码部署到目标环境中。部署包括安装和配置软件、数据迁移等。部署完成后,需要进行维护和更新,以确保软件的正常运行和持续改进。
综上所述,编程方法和操作流程对于成功开发和维护软件非常重要。开发者应根据具体的项目需求和团队的实际情况选择合适的编程方法和遵循适当的操作流程。
1年前 -